Output bc56e811022670eefc091a4ee433d205c695a5981ab7b4bbaa03c6526c742896:3

value
13799572
script pubkey
OP_0 OP_PUSHBYTES_32 d31c5d13d0ce6604c5d69201eaee358902d7969a9e61e3cce7b56fe47a340fdd
address
bc1q6vw96y7seenqf3wkjgq74m343ypd0956nes78n88k4h7g735plws34h2gs
transaction
bc56e811022670eefc091a4ee433d205c695a5981ab7b4bbaa03c6526c742896